The Sony/Tektronix AWG2005 is a 20 MS/s, 12-bit arbitrary waveform generator introduced in 1995.

Key Specifications

Frequency Point clock 0.01 Hz to 20 MHz, 4 digit resolution (Opt.05: 7 digits)
Channels 2 outputs (Opt.02: 4 outputs), 12 bit resolution; auxiliary marker output (2 V pulse into 50 Ω) per channel; low pass filters 0.5/1/2/5 MHz
Functions Sine, triangle, Square, Ramp, Pulse and Arbitrary; min. 16 points
Output Range: 50 mVp-pto 10 Vp-p (1 mV increments) into 50 Ω (source impedance 50 Ω), -5 V to +5 V offset (5 mV increments), -200 mA to 200 mA as current source
Memory 64K x 12 bits waveform per channel, can position 256 data point boundary in the waveform memory, 256 waveforms maximum; catalog memory 4 Mb
Storage 512K internal NVRAM (Li battery soldered on main board), 3.5" floppy drive
Sweep Linear, Log, Arbitrary; Continuous, Triggered, Gated modes
Interfaces GPIB, RS-232; direct transfers from TDS Series, 2200/2400 series, 11000 Series, AFG2020 or AWG20XX series
Display Monochrome CRT, 640×480px., 132 mm × 99 mm display area
Power 100−250 VAC, ≤300 W; fan cooled
Dimensions 160 mm × 360 mm × 490 mm (H/W/L); 10.7 kg (23.5 lb)
Options
  • Opt. 02 − two additional output channels
  • Opt. 04 − TTL level 12-bit data plus clock output (rear panel)
  • Opt. 05 − Edit clock sweep
  • Opt. 09 − Edit in frequency domain (floating point processor)
